BMP(Basic Multilingual Plane)开发平台是一种基于互联网技术的应用程序开发平台,用于快速构建跨平台的移动应用程序。它提供了一套丰富的开发工具和框架,使开发者能够轻松地创建高性能、稳定、可定制的移动应用。
BMP开发平台的原理是基于一种称为增量式开发的方法。这种开发方法允许开发者在不改变现有代码的情况下,通过添加新的功能和模块来扩展应用程序。这使得开发过程更加高效和灵活,同时也减少了开发周期和成本。
BMP开发平台具有以下主要特点:
1. 跨平台兼容性:BMP开发平台使用一种称为HTML5的标准化技术,能够在不同的操作系统(如iOS、Android、Windows等)上运行。这意味着开发者只需编写一次代码,就可以在不同的平台上部署和运行应用程序。
2. 多样化的开发工具:BMP开发平台提供了一套全面的开发工具,包括代码编辑器、调试器、图形界面设计工具等。这些工具使开发者能够快速、简单地创建和调整应用程序的外观和功能。
3. 强大的功能支持:BMP开发平台支持多种功能模块,如地理位置定位、网络连接、多媒体处理等。开发者可以根据应用需求选择和集成这些模块,以提供更多样化和丰富的用户体验。
4. 稳定性和安全性:BMP开发平台采用一种称为Web容器的技术,可以确保应用程序在不同设备上的稳定运行。同时,它还提供了一套完善的安全机制,以保护用户数据和应用程序的安全。
5. 可扩展性和可定制性:BMP开发平台提供了一套强大的应用程序接口(API),允许开发者根据应用需求进行定制和扩展。开发者可以利用这些API来实现特定功能、集成第三方服务等。
总结起来,BMP开发平台是一种基于互联网技术的跨平台开发平台,通过增量式开发方法和一系列丰富的开发工具,可以快速构建高性能、稳定、可定制的移动应用程序。它具有跨平台兼容性、多样化的开发工具、强大的功能支持、稳定性和安全性、可扩展性和可定制性等特点。对于那些希望快速构建移动应用的开发者来说,BMP开发平台是一个非常有吸引力的选择。